Recently I was sitting with my friend in a computer hardware shop and I saw some motherboards over there, some of them were of brown color and some where of green color and when asked about the difference they said difference is in the quality.
But still I am not convinced and satisfied with their answer. So I want some real answers regarding the difference between both colored mother boards.

you can not say the quality of the board is better duo to it's color. some manufactures use different colors for they boards to make differences between their usage. like some manufactures use black to say it is for professional use but some other use red to say it's for professional use and blue for normal users. but these colors have no relations with quality of the boards and this color is only the dialectic layer color which you can see. but anyway i don't think any new motherboard will have the brown color (i haven't seen these days) so probably you can say a brown motherboard is not from recent years (but maybe there is a manufacture which still produces in brown that i don't know).
